Wall Maintenance
Examining walls for any blemishes and quickly addressing them through essential fixings is vital for attaining a smooth and remarkable paint work. Before starting the paint procedure, meticulously check out the wall surfaces for fractures, openings, dents, or any other damages that might influence the outcome.
Begin by filling out any kind of fractures or openings with spackling compound, permitting it to dry entirely before sanding it down to produce a smooth surface area. Additionally, check for any type of loosened paint or wallpaper that might require to be gotten rid of. Remove any kind of pe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to produce an uniform structure.
It's additionally essential to examine for water damages, as this can lead to mold and mildew development and influence the adhesion of the brand-new paint. Attend to any water stains or mold with the suitable cleaning services before waging the paint process.
Cleaning and Surface Area Preparation
To guarantee a beautiful and well-prepared surface area for paint, the following step entails extensively cleansing and prepping the walls. Begin by dusting the walls with a microfiber fabric or a duster to get rid of any kind of loosened dust, cobwebs, or particles.
For even more persistent dust or crud, an option of light detergent and water can be utilized to delicately scrub the wall surfaces, complied with by a detailed rinse with tidy water. Pay special interest to locations near light switches, door takes care of, and baseboards, as these have a tendency to gather more dust.
After cleaning, it is necessary to evaluate the wall surfaces for any type of cracks, openings, or flaws. These need to be full of spackling substance and sanded smooth as soon as dry. Priming and Insulation
Before paint, the walls must be keyed to make certain proper attachment of the paint and taped to protect nearby surface areas from stray brushstrokes. Priming acts as a critical step in the painting process, specifically for brand-new drywall or surfaces that have been patched or repaired. It aids secure the wall surface, producing a smooth and uniform surface for the paint to abide by. Additionally, guide can boost the sturdiness and protection of the paint, eventually bring about a more expert and long-lasting finish.
When it concerns taping, using pain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and various other surface areas you want to secure is important to achieve tidy and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is developed to be quickly applied and removed without harming the underlying surface or leaving any type of deposit. Take the time to effectively tape off areas before painting to conserve yourself the trouble of touch-ups later on.
